Buildings with mechanical ventilation use fans to supply air to, and exhaust air from, the rooms. Mixed-mode ventilation combines mechanical ventilation with the use of natural driving forces. Mixed-mode systems are either low pressure fan assisted mechanical systems or two mode ventilation systems operating mechanical ventilation or natural ventilation depending on conditions. In commercial buildings the ventilation rates and requirements are usually higher than that in residential buildings. The idea of mechanical ventilation system is that the required ventilation rate can be maintained in all weather conditions without influence of occupants of the building. In mechanical exhaust ventilation systems air is exhausted from the rooms having higher pollutant generation and lower air quality. Mechanical supply and exhaust ventilation provides effective filtering of outdoor air. This has great importance in urban areas with high traffic or industrial combustion loads. Constant air volume systems may be easily combined with natural ventilation through openings resulting as mixed-mode ventilation system.
